1. Introduction: What is a Tourniquet and Its Role in Emergency Care

A tourniquet is a constricting or compressing device used to control venous and arterial circulation to an extremity for a period of time. Primarily utilized in emergency medicine, military combat, and surgical settings, tourniquets are critical for stopping life-threatening hemorrhages. Modern tourniquets have evolved from simple straps and sticks into sophisticated medical devices, including pneumatic, windlass, and elastic models. The global demand for tourniquets has surged due to increased awareness of trauma care, mass casualty incidents, and stringent workplace safety regulations. 4. Application Scenarios and Solutions

4.1 Military and Combat Medicine

Tourniquets are standard-issue in military first aid kits. The solution involves lightweight, one-handed application devices like the CAT Gen7. Factories produce windlass-style tourniquets with high tensile strength webbing and durable windlass rods.

4.2 Emergency Medical Services (EMS) and Pre-Hospital Care

EMS providers require rapid-deployment tourniquets. Solutions include pre-packaged, color-coded devices with integrated pressure indicators. Pneumatic tourniquets are used in ambulance settings for controlled hemorrhage control.

4.3 Surgical and Operating Room Use

In orthopedic and vascular surgeries, pneumatic tourniquet systems provide a bloodless field. Factories supply cuffs in multiple sizes (adult, pediatric, thigh) with automatic pressure regulation and safety alarms.

4.4 Industrial and Workplace Safety

Factories produce heavy-duty tourniquets for first aid kits in construction, mining, and manufacturing. Solutions include ruggedized, weather-resistant models with clear instructions printed on the device.

5. Frequently Asked Questions (10 FAQs)

  1. What is the difference between a windlass and pneumatic tourniquet? Windlass tourniquets use a mechanical rod to tighten, ideal for field use. Pneumatic tourniquets use air pressure, suitable for surgical settings.
  2. How long can a tourniquet be safely applied? Generally, up to 2 hours. Continuous application beyond 2 hours risks nerve damage and limb ischemia.

12. Why Choose Small and Medium Factories? Differences from Large Factories

Advantages of Small and Medium Factories (SMEs)

SMEs offer greater flexibility in custom orders, lower MOQs (500-2,000 units), and faster response times. They are ideal for startups, niche medical brands, and regional distributors. SMEs often provide more competitive pricing for short runs and can adapt quickly to design changes.

Differences from Large Factories

Large factories (e.g., Weigao, Stryker) have higher production capacity (millions of units annually), advanced R&D, and global regulatory compliance teams. However, they require larger MOQs (10,000+ units), longer lead times, and have less flexibility for small customizations. Large factories are better suited for government tenders, military contracts, and large hospital networks. SMEs are preferred for pilot projects, private label brands, and regional market entry.
